【PHP】下らねぇ質問はID出して書き込みやがれ 81at PHP【PHP】下らねぇ質問はID出して書き込みやがれ 81 - 暇つぶし2ch■コピペモード□スレを通常表示□オプションモード□このスレッドのURL■項目テキスト358:357 09/02/23 16:02:51 yJ3BEx4Z ID出すの忘れ 359:nobodyさん 09/02/23 16:12:39 あれ、流出してる? 360:nobodyさん 09/02/23 16:31:29 >>352 eval(mb_convert_encoding(file_get_contents('test.txt'), 'Shift-JIS', 'UTF-8')); >>357 構文に間違いはないから スクリプトのエンコーディングが mbstring.script_encoding と合ってないんでしょう 361:nobodyさん 09/02/23 16:37:17 yJ3BEx4Z 可能の能抜いたらエラー出なかったです・・・ なんなのだろう 362:nobodyさん 09/02/23 16:46:30 >>357 原因は、Shift Jisの5C問題だね。 能のShift Jisのコードが94 5C 5Cはバックスラッシュ(Shift Jisだと¥)なので、 PHPのパーサが、終わりのダブルクォーテーションを文字列と認識してしまう。 結果、文字列が閉じられていないと判断されて、エラーになる。 363:nobodyさん 09/02/23 17:31:12 今時SJISでスクリプト書くやつなんていんの? 話は変わるが echo '<table ~'. '~~~~~~~~~'. '~~~~~~~~~'. '~~~~~~~~~'. '~~~~~~~~~'; 引継ぎでプログラムのソースコード見たらこうなってた まじ簡便してくれ・・・orz あと、同じ要領でechoでJavaScriptとか吐き出してるのもやめてくれ クエリはまだ許せる 仕事でプログラムするときはほかの人にわかりやすいコードにしてください これまじでお願い 次ページ最新レス表示レスジャンプ類似スレ一覧スレッドの検索話題のニュースおまかせリストオプションしおりを挟むスレッドに書込スレッドの一覧暇つぶし2ch